3About Hala
Hala is a small Lancashire village just outside Lancaster, easily reached via the A6 from M6 Junction 33 or 34. The area has over 40 EV charging points for longer journeys to the Lakes or Scotland. It forms part of a cluster of historic villages including Newlands and Bowerham, all connected by quiet country lanes that wind through typical Lancashire countryside of green fields and scattered woodlands.
